XYT Microfinishing polishing films are essential in the automotive industry for achieving precise surface finishes on critical components such as camshafts, crankshafts, and transmission parts. These films consist of micron-graded abrasive minerals bonded to a durable polyester backing, enabling consistent and controlled material removal to meet exacting tolerances.
Types of Microfinishing Polishing Films:
-
Aluminum Oxide Films:
- Description: Utilize micron-graded aluminum oxide abrasives known for a fast cut rate and uniform finish.
- Applications: Ideal for polishing metal components, including automotive powertrain parts.
-
Diamond Microfinishing Films:
- Description: Feature micron-graded diamond abrasives, the hardest known material, providing rapid cutting action and superior durability.
- Applications: Suitable for polishing extremely hard materials and achieving ultra-smooth finishes on components like camshafts and crankshafts.
Grit Equivalents:
Microfinishing films are specified by micron sizes, with common conversions as follows:
Micron Size | Approximate Grit Equivalent |
---|---|
100 µm | ~150 grit |
80 µm | ~180 grit |
60 µm | ~240 grit |
40 µm | ~320 grit |
30 µm | ~400 grit |
15 µm | ~600 grit |
9 µm | ~1200 grit |
6 µm | ~2500 grit |
3 µm | ~4000 grit |
1 µm | ~8000 grit |
0.5 µm | ~10000 grit |
0.3 µm | ~20000 grit |
These equivalents assist in selecting the appropriate film for each stage of the polishing process, from initial material removal to final finishing.

Polishing Process:
- Surface Preparation: Clean the component to remove contaminants.
- Initial Polishing: Use coarser films (e.g., 100 µm) for material removal.
- Intermediate Polishing: Progress to medium grades (e.g., 30 µm) to refine the surface.
- Final Polishing: Utilize fine films (e.g., 9 µm) to achieve a mirror-like finish.
- Inspection: Verify the surface meets required specifications.
Consistent pressure, appropriate lubrication, and proper equipment are crucial throughout the process to ensure optimal results.
